I would like to whether the following sentences are correct. If yes, kindly tell me the difference in their meaning.
1) Who taught you how to ride a bike?
2) Who taught you to ride a bike?

Both of those are correct. The meaning is the same. In other words 'how' is optional. Even though it's optional, it's almost always used.
